#27062d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27062d is composed of 15.3% red, 2.4%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 290.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 10%. #27062d color hex could be obtained by blending #4e0c5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#27062d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010a is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#27062d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b181b is the less saturated color, while #2b0033 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#27062d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#141414 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#181119 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#00203f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#142133 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#2e1b1d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#0e1638 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1b1731 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#2b1323 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
